What Exactly is an APK?
First things first, what is an APK? APK stands for Android Package Kit. Think of it as the digital wrapper for Android apps. It's the file format that Android uses to distribute and install apps. When you download an app from the Google Play Store, you're essentially downloading an APK file. However, APKs can also be found on various websites and app stores outside of the official Google Play Store. This is where things can get a little dicey. The Google Play Store has security measures in place to scan apps for malware and other malicious code before they're made available for download. These measures aren't foolproof, but they do provide a significant layer of protection. When you download an APK from a third-party source, you're bypassing these security checks, which can expose you to a number of risks. The Dark Side of APKs: Security Risks
Now for the bad news: APKs, especially those from untrusted sources, can be riddled with security vulnerabilities. We're talking malware, spyware, ransomware – the whole scary shebang! Imagine downloading what you think is a fun new game, only to find out it's secretly stealing your passwords and credit card details. Not cool, right? One of the most common risks is malware injection. This is where malicious code is inserted into a legitimate APK file. The modified APK looks and functions like the original app, but it also contains hidden malware that can perform a variety of malicious activities. This malware can steal your personal data, track your location, send spam messages, or even take control of your device. Another risk is data leakage. Some APKs may contain vulnerabilities that allow attackers to access sensitive data stored on your device, such as your contacts, photos, and emails. This data can then be used for identity theft, phishing attacks, or other malicious purposes. Furthermore, some APKs may request excessive permissions. Permissions are the access rights that an app needs to function properly. However, some apps may request permissions that are not necessary for their functionality. For example, a simple flashlight app shouldn't need access to your contacts or location. If an app requests excessive permissions, it could be a sign that it's trying to collect more data than it needs or that it's engaging in other malicious activities. How to Spot a Shady APK
Okay, so how do you, as a regular Android user, actually tell if an APK is dodgy? Here are a few red flags to watch out for. First, the source. As we've hammered home, downloading from unofficial app stores or random websites is a major risk. Stick to the Google Play Store whenever possible. Even then, pay attention to the developer. Is it a well-known company or some random name you've never heard of? Second, check the permissions the app is asking for. Does a simple calculator app really need access to your camera and microphone? Probably not! Be wary of apps requesting excessive or unnecessary permissions. Third, read the reviews! User reviews can be a goldmine of information. Look for reviews that mention suspicious behavior, like the app draining battery life, displaying excessive ads, or requesting unusual permissions. A sudden influx of positive reviews might also be a sign that the developer is trying to artificially inflate the app's rating. Fourth, pay attention to the file size. If an APK file is significantly larger or smaller than expected, it could be a sign that it has been tampered with. Fifth, use a virus scanner. There are many free and paid antivirus apps available for Android that can scan APK files for malware before you install them. While these scanners aren't perfect, they can provide an extra layer of protection. Sixth, trust your gut. If something about an APK seems fishy, don't download it! Safe APK Practices: Keeping Your Android Secure
Alright, so you know the risks, you know how to spot a dodgy APK, but what practical steps can you take to stay safe? Let's break it down. Firstly, enable Google Play Protect. This is Google's built-in malware scanner, and it's actually pretty good! It scans apps before you download them and regularly checks your installed apps for malicious behavior. Make sure it's turned on in your Google Play Store settings. Secondly, keep your Android operating system up to date. Security updates often include patches for vulnerabilities that can be exploited by malicious APKs. Thirdly, be mindful of the permissions you grant to apps. Only grant permissions that are absolutely necessary for the app to function properly. If an app asks for a permission that seems suspicious, deny it! Fourthly, regularly back up your data. In the event that your device is infected with malware, you can restore your data from a backup without losing any important information. Fifthly, consider using a VPN (Virtual Private Network). A VPN can encrypt your internet traffic and protect your privacy, making it more difficult for attackers to intercept your data. The Future of APK Security
So, what does the future hold for APK security? Well, the good news is that Google is constantly working to improve the security of the Android ecosystem. They're developing new technologies to detect and prevent malware, and they're working to make it easier for developers to build secure apps. One promising development is the increasing use of app signing. App signing is a process that allows developers to digitally sign their APKs, which helps to ensure that the app has not been tampered with since it was created. When you install a signed APK, Android verifies the signature to ensure that the app is authentic. Another area of focus is improving the permission system. Google is working to make it easier for users to understand what permissions an app is requesting and why. They're also working to give users more control over their data. However, the fight against malicious APKs is an ongoing battle. As Google improves its security measures, attackers are constantly developing new ways to bypass them.
